In 1499 (the twelfth year of Hongzhi’s reign), a scandal unfolded during the Metropolitan Examination. Hua Chang, Supervising Secretary of the Office of Scrutiny for Revenue, accused Cheng Minzheng, Right Vice Minister of Rites, of accepting a bribe and leaking the examination questions to two Scholar Passed Metropolitan Examination candidates: Xu Jing from Jiangyin County and Tang Yin from Wu County.
